Transaction 585162f4ff2c79293192f07d8f499ca5bcab304a867916b97fc6d685200f15a2
1 Input
1 Output
-
585162f4ff2c79293192f07d8f499ca5bcab304a867916b97fc6d685200f15a2:0
- value
- 862127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e246e9407200e06caaa0e1124876bafe1906789 OP_EQUAL
- address
- 34SPqdmGthpEbkJKApg3HGjdUEN31mwrPW